    Can I use the plugin to test the updates, and after that update the main site and delete the staging site? will I have FTP access to upload files?

Viewing 11 replies - 1 through 11 (of 11 total)
  • Plugin Contributor alaasalama

    (@alaasalama)

    Hi,

    Thanks for asking this question.

    Yes, sure you can test any kind of updates (WordPress core, plugin, theme) on the staging site, and when you are sure it’s all good, you can replicate that on the production site and delete the staging site.

    By default the staging site will be at a sub-directory of your production site, something like (example.com/staging/), so you can easily access the staging site’s folder via FTP the same way you do for the production site.

    Thanks for all the help, I want to start testing the plugin and notice something about the database, will the changes not apply to the main site database? Will the plugin create new database or new “prefix” that not apply to the current database?

    Plugin Contributor alaasalama

    (@alaasalama)

    Using a new database for the staging site is not included in the free version, so you are right, it will create a new “prefix” for the staging site that won’t affect the live site at all.

    Thread Starter mstudioIL

    (@mstudioil)

    OK, thanks, can I control the “prefix” or to know it name?|
    As long it don’t effect the current site it is OK with by me

    Plugin Contributor alaasalama

    (@alaasalama)

    Cloning to a whole new database will allow you to choose the database table prefix, but using the free version the plugin will generate something like (wpstg0_, wpstg1_ “for the next staging site you create”, wpstg2_, etc…). And you can’t control that.
